本教程将向您展示如何在 Debian 10 服务器/桌面上安装 Jellyfin 媒体服务器。 Jellyfin 是一款免费的开源应用程序,可让您在一个漂亮的界面中组织电影、电视节目、音乐和照片,并通过网络或通过网络在 PC、平板电脑、手机、电视、Roku 等设备上流式传输这些媒体文件互联网。 Jellyfin 可以安装在 Linux、MacOS 和 Windows 上。
Jellyfin 特点
Jellyfin 是 Emby 媒体服务器的一个分支。 它包含许多与 Plex 和 Emby 相同的功能。
- 与 Plex 或 Emby 不同,Jellyfin 是 100% 免费和开源的。 无广告。 移动应用程序没有播放限制。 (虽然 iOS 应用无法在后台播放视频。)
- 观看直播电视并设置自动录制以扩展您的媒体库。
- 自动从 TheTVDB、TheMovieDB、OpenMovie Database 和 Rotten Tomatoes 获取艺术品、元数据。
- 支持DLNA。
- 可以安装可选插件以提供附加功能。
- 支持使用 FFMpeg 进行视频编码/解码的硬件加速。
- 和更多。
在 Debian 10 上安装 Jellyfin 媒体服务器
Jellyfin 不包含在默认的 Debian 存储库中,但它有自己的存储库。 运行以下命令将 Jellyfin 存储库添加到您的 Debian 10 系统。
echo "deb [arch=$( dpkg --print-architecture )] https://repo.jellyfin.org/debian buster main" | sudo tee /etc/apt/sources.list.d/jellyfin.list
接下来,运行以下命令将 Jeffyfin GPG 密钥导入 Debian 系统,以便 APT 在安装过程中验证软件包完整性。
wget -O - https://repo.jellyfin.org/jellyfin_team.gpg.key | sudo apt-key add -
而且因为这个仓库使用的是HTTPS连接,所以我们还需要安装 apt-transport-https
和 ca-certificates
包裹。
sudo apt install apt-transport-https ca-certificates
最后,更新 Debian 系统上的软件包索引并安装 Jellyfin。
sudo apt update sudo apt install jellyfin
此命令还将安装 3 个其他软件包作为依赖项:
jellyfin-ffmpeg
: 用于视频转码。jellyfin-server
: 后端服务器。jellyfin-web
: 前端网页界面。
现在 Jellyfin 媒体服务器已安装,我们可以使用以下命令检查其状态:
systemctl status jellyfin
如您所见,它在我的 Debian 10 系统上运行。 (按 q
键收回终端控制权。)